Technical challenges: How to play chess in microgravity?

Playing chess in space is not as simple as taking a board to the ISS. Microgravity poses unique challenges that force you to rethink game design. On Earth, Pieces are held in place by gravity, but in space, Any sudden movement could cause them to fly away., interrupting the game or even damaging sensitive equipment.

The most obvious solution is to use magnetic boards. In fact, the NASA has already tested magnetic versions of board games on the ISS, like chess. The pieces, Made with light but resistant materials, such as aluminum or reinforced plastic, They adhere to the board using magnets. However, this doesn't solve all the problems. In an environment where objects float freely, even a small mistake when moving a piece could destabilize the entire board. For this reason, some engineers propose boards with vacuum clamping systems, similar to those used in surgical operating tables, that would keep the pieces stationary without the need for magnets.

Another alternative is the digital chess. Tablets and touch screens are already common on the ISS, and chess software adapted to spatial conditions could be the most practical solution. Companies like Chess.com o Lichess They have developed versions that allow you to play online, even with communication delays, something essential for games between Mars and Earth. Nevertheless, Physical chess has a symbolic and tactile value that digital chess cannot replicate., especially on long duration missions where contact with real objects can be therapeutic.

A less obvious but equally important aspect is the parts material. in space, objects are exposed to cosmic radiation, which can degrade certain plastics or paints. Besides, Pieces must be large enough to be handled with gloves, but not enough to take up valuable space on the ship. The ESA has experimented with 3D printers on the ISS, which opens up the possibility of manufacturing custom parts on site, adapted to the needs of each mission.

Interplanetary departures: The future of chess?

Imagining a chess game between an astronaut on Mars and a player on Earth seems like something out of a science fiction novel., but the technology already exists to make it happen. The main challenge is not the game itself, but the delay in communications. Depending on the relative position of Mars and Earth, signals may take between 3 y 22 minutes to travel from one planet to another. This means that a real-time game would be impossible, but not an adapted version.

One solution is the correspondence chess, a format in which players submit their moves in turns, no strict time limit. This method is already used on Earth, especially in international competitions, and would be ideal for space missions. Platforms like Chess.com allow you to play with delays, and astronauts could send their movements through the space's communication networks. NASA o to ESA.
